Я хочу Интегрировать свое веб-приложение C#.NET с онлайн-версией QuickBook.
Я плохо знаком с этим и использованием asp.net 3,5 платформы для моего приложения. Я хочу интегрировать данные платежной ведомости сотрудника своего приложения к QBOE для создания PayChecks. Таким образом, что API я должен использовать? Я считал и загрузил QBWC, но не получение большой идеи или шагов.
Помогите мне удовлетворить требования к приложению.
Заранее спасибо, Vimal
В настоящее время QuickBooks SDK предоставляет вам самый широкий диапазон доступа к данным онлайн-издания. Однако вы не сможете создавать чеки. Самое близкое к данным о заработной плате - это создать записи в табеле учета рабочего времени, которые пользователь может преобразовать в чеки с помощью процесса расчета заработной платы QuickBooks. Сами чеки и все, что вы видите на экране заработной платы, заблокировано Intuit.
Следует отметить, что QuickBooks SDK очень гибкий и дает вам доступ почти ко всем областям программы, но не к расчету заработной платы, извините. Вы можете создавать чеки расходов с помощью SDK, но я сомневаюсь, что этого будет достаточно для расчета заработной платы.
Вы не можете использовать Web Connector с QuickBooks Online Edition. Web Connector предназначен для использования только с настольными версиями QuickBooks.
QuickBooks Online Edition предоставляет HTTP API, который можно использовать для связи с ним. Обычно вы отправляете запросы HTTP POST с данными XML на сервер QuickBooks Online, и он отвечает ответами XML.
В QuickBooks SDK и в моей вики есть документация, показывающая процесс установки: Процесс настройки QuickBooks Online
И еще несколько примеров запросов / ответов XML: Пример запроса / ответа qbXML
Дополнительную документацию по запросам qbXML, которые вы можете отправлять, можно найти здесь: QuickBooks OSR
Следует отметить, что вы не можете создавать чеки. Intuit не дает вам возможности программно создавать чеки. Самое близкое, что вы можете получить, - это создание таблиц учета рабочего времени с помощью запроса TimeTrackingAdd, которые затем можно преобразовать в чеки / платежные ведомости в графическом интерфейсе QuickBooks Online.